In earlier days, many Indian parents used to contact an astrologer to prepare the horoscope of their child and based on the recommendations of the astrologer a suitable name was kept from the alphabet suggested by them. In more recent times, lack of access to astrologers and the ambition of finding the most unique name for the apple of their eyes, Indian parents are turning towards numerology to name their babies.
It is not just the Indian television producers and filmmakers that are eager to add an extra ‘a’ or ‘t’ in their names, many Indian parents are all too willing to name their son “Hreehaan” instead of Rehaan meaning compassion because their numerologists told them so. The numerologist may even suggest reversing some alphabets or make other modifications in the baby’s name.
